Karen Louise Bennett of Eustis, Florida passed away on Tuesday, February 22, 2022 at the age of 70. She was born in Elmira, New York and moved to Eustis 3 years ago from Horseheads, New York. Karen worked as a confidential secretary for the Chemung County District Attorney’s office for 27 years. She met the love of her life, Alan Bennett and after 5 years they were married. After retiring from the DA’s office, she worked as a school crossing guard for the Elmira Heights School District. When Karen retired, she and Alan traveled and decided to make an extended stay in Eustis. Karen was a Disney fanatic. She loved everything Disney. She enjoyed cross stitch and crocheting and like to do puzzles. Karen loved the outdoors and enjoyed going fishing and just sitting and watching the birds. 

She was preceded in death by her brother, Paul O’Hare in 2019. Karen is remembered and will be dearly missed by her husband of 30 years, Alan; daughters, Jennifer (Larry) Starkweather of Milton, Pennsylvania, Alisha Bennett of Elmira and Kendall (Joey) Lanzillotto of Horseheads; son, Jeremy Waltimire of Elmira Heights; sisters, Sandy Beach of Palm Bay, Florida, Cheryl (Larry) Coon of Corning, New York and Marcia (Carlos) Mejia of Dawsonville, Georgia; and grandchildren, Mitchell Rockwell of Horseheads, Dominick Waltimire of Elmira Heights, Atticus Waltimire of Elmira Heights, Sage Barto of Milton, Pennsylvania, Colby (Rei) Barto of North Carolina, Logan Barta of Milton, Kyleigh Bennett and Elizabeth Bennet, both of Elmira.
